Complaints reaardina violations: Whenever a violation of this chapter occurs. or <br />is alleaed to have occurred. any person may file a written complaint. Such complaints <br />shall state fully the causes and basis thereof and shall be filed with the Heritaae <br />Preservation Commission. The Commission shall record properly such complaint. and <br />immediately direct the official to investiaate. and take action thereon as provided by this <br />chapter. <br /> <br />E. Appeals. Any person aaarieved by a violation notice and order to take action <br />as required by the City shall have the riaht to appeal. The City Council may uphold the <br />violation. void all violations. or chanae any described violation by addina violations. <br />removina violations or chanaina the order to take required action. <br /> <br />F. Appeal Procedure. Any property owner or owner's aaent that has been served <br />with a violation notice and an order to take required action shall have the riaht to appeal <br />the order to the City Council within thirty (30) calendar days after receivina the <br />compliance order. All appeals shall be made to the Heritaae Preservation Commission <br />in writina with any information to substantiate the appeal. The appeal shall be <br />considered by the City Council under section 2.04 of the City Code. <br /> <br />SUBD. 8. REPOSITORY FOR DOCUMENTS.
